Algoma University Scholarships

Algoma University may provide students with scholarships of up to $5000 CAD to support project fees and travel costs through its Global Learning Grant

  • Eligibility depends on your personal circumstances. (See more details below)
  • Must be available to join a 1-month project in Fiji or Bali from the end of May or early June. (See details below)
Application Process
  1. Apply online to Think Pacific, before 28th Nov 2024.
  2. If shortlisted, you will be requested to interview on either the 6th or 8th Dec 2024.
  3. If successful, you will be asked to confirm your place before the 18th Jan 2025.

If you have any questions about funding or eligibility, please contact university staff on: goabroad@algomau.ca

More Funding Information
What Funding is Available to Apply for?

Algoma University may provide students with scholarships to support project fees and travel costs through its Global Skills Opportunity project.

Students who traditionally face barriers to participation in international learning opportunities (students with disabilities, Indigenous students, and low-income students) may be eligible for additional support on a needs basis.

The costs in Canadian dollars for Algoma students are:

  • Registration Fee = $95 CAD
  • Project Fee = $3600 CAD
  • Flights = $2,500 CAD (approximately)

All Algoma University students registered in a 3- or 4-year degree program are eligible to apply to participate in a Think Pacific experience. International students are recommended to check Fiji or Bali VISA requirements and study permit implications before applying. International students are not eligible to apply for funding.

Students must meet the following eligibility requirements to apply for funding:

  • Be a domestic (Canadian) student or permanent resident
  • Have completed a minimum of 30 credits at Algoma University
  • Be between the ages of 18 and 69
  • Have a minimum overall average of 70% with no history of academic probation
  • Are in good academic standing and in an academic degree program
  • Are able to fulfill the requirements of the Global Learning Leadership Skills Development Program, which includes complete pre-departure training sessions and the completion of complete an e-portfolio upon return to Canada
  • Are returning to studies in F25
  • Have (or be willing to apply for) a valid Canadian passport valid for at least six months from the date of travel

Preference will be given to Indigenous students, students with disabilities, and low income students.

Our Projects in Fiji 🇫🇯

Become a member of a Fijian family and work within a team whilst contributing to sustainable development initiatives that support the achievement of the Fiji National Development Plan.

Our projects in Fiji are truly unique. They take place in rural communities which are a world away from the usual crowds and the average volunteer projects. The villages in Fiji are only accessible upon invitation by the chief, which means you can sample a way of life that few people will ever be fortunate enough to see.
